Specific Locomotive History

No. 51234 | BR 

Introduced by the L&Y in 1906 as no. 832, this engine served British Railways until 1957. It operated from both Newton Heath (East Manchester) and Bank Hall (Liverpool) sheds while wearing the BR identity depicted here.
